AI Contract Overview
The contract seeks specialized services to embed gender equity, disability inclusion, and social inclusion principles into every stage of program implementation, including verification design, field operations, and reporting. This engagement requires deep expertise in integrating these principles across diverse contexts to ensure equitable outcomes and meaningful participation of marginalized groups. The work will be performed within the National Capital Region and is structured as a subcontract under the Department of Foreign Affairs, Trade and Development, Government of Canada. Proposals must be submitted by June 22, 2026, and the solicitation falls under NAICS code 611710, indicating a focus on educational support services or professional consultancy in social inclusion frameworks. While no set-aside provisions are specified, the contract emphasizes inclusive practices in both process and outcomes, requiring responders to demonstrate proven experience in applying GESI methodologies within international development or government programs. The objective is to ensure that all program activities are designed and executed with an acute awareness of intersecting inequalities and barriers faced by women, persons with disabilities, and other socially excluded populations.
